    Abstract:

    This study analyzed the influence of the design of integrated curriculum of civil engineering majors and the change of the completion semester of subjects on the quality of students'' major knowledge system and graduation projects according to the concept of CDIO engineering education based on conceive, design, element and operation. Through this, the integrated curriculum plan of the architectural courses will be reviewed to improve the quality of the graduation project and the practical abilities. This study was conducted on graduates from 2017-2020 of the university to which the author belongs. This research figured out that the integrated curriculum plan of architectural courses can effectively improve students'' comprehensive mastery of architectural knowledge. Furthermore, although the teaching team has a clear understanding of the coherence between architectural courses from the perspective of "teaching", but the students still do not have a clear understanding of the coherence between the courses from the perspective of "receiving". They stayed in mastering the contents of each course, which failed to meet the "integrated learning experiences" required by CDIO.
